Does that have a separate hydrualic motor that you mount somewhere? How do it work? I am thinking of going with this as opposed to buying the rear pto and pto tiller. I think all X series can get the rear PTO which is a dealer upgrade.
 
/ love this tractor
  • Thread Starter
#10  
Yes, the pump mounts under the tractor pretty easily, then you just hook up the shaft. I like the hydraulic tiller because of the indirect
power supply, if a rock gets hung in the tines it has a clutch action
which gives you a couple seconds to kill the pto switch, probobly easier on the shear pins as well. Get the skid shoes with it .
they are great for hard clay, just adjust it down a notch at a time
until you reach the desired depth.
